The St. Tommy NYPD Omnibus, Vol. I
by Declan FinnIn the mean streets of New York—and beyond—evil has a scent. And one cop can smell it.
Detective Thomas “Tommy” Nolan is a good man: devoted husband and father, faithful Catholic, and an NYPD officer who shows mercy to the desperate while hunting the truly wicked. Then the gifts arrive—the charisms of the saints. He can smell evil. He can bilocate. He heals fast, levitates when needed, and stands as a living target for the legions of Hell.
From a demon-possessed serial killer tearing through Queens to death cults, warlocks in high office, Nazi vampires, sex-trafficking succubi, witches, zombies, Lovecraftian horrors, and worse, every force of darkness marks Tommy for destruction. They learn the hard way that “good” does not mean “harmless.” With prayer, fists, firearms, allies from the Vatican to the streets, and an unshakable faith, Tommy sends them all back to Hell—or dies trying.
This complete collection gathers every novel and short story in Declan Finn’s acclaimed Saint Tommy, NYPD series: the full arc of Tommy’s battles across New York, Europe, and the supernatural underworld, plus the connecting tales that fill the gaps between major cases. Experience the Catholic action-horror that readers call a streamlined, faith-fueled answer to urban fantasy classics—fast-paced, gun-and-grace-filled, and unapologetically on the side of the light.
One saint. One badge. An army of demons. The war against Evil starts here.
The first omnibus volume of the St. Tommy NYPD series includes these three novels:
Hell Spawn: Nolan discovers his gifts from God. Then a demonic serial killer discovers him.
Death Cult: The cultists who raised the demon have decided they need a new human sacrifice: and Nolan is it.
Infernal Affairs: Nolan has meddled in the affairs of demons once too often, and a bounty is put on his head. Can he find the warlock before the hunters can collect?
Short stories.
One Ranger: For some people, hunting the demonic is a generational family business.
Lupus Dei: A coven wants to hunt the most dangerous game. This prey hunts back.
